PLDT Inc. (PHI) - Canvas Business Model: Value Propositions

You're looking at the core reasons why customers choose PLDT Inc. (PHI) over the competition, grounded in the actual performance metrics as of late 2025. It's about the scale of the integrated network and the specific, measurable benefits delivered by each segment.

Fully integrated fixed, wireless, and ICT services ecosystem

PLDT Inc. remains the country's largest fully integrated telecommunications company, which means you get services spanning fixed line, wireless, and enterprise digital solutions all under one roof. This integration supports a massive infrastructure footprint that underpins all offerings.

The network scale as of late 2025 is substantial:

  • The PLDT Group's fiber backbone spans approximately 1.24 million cable kilometers of domestic and international fiber as of September 2025.
  • Smart's combined 5G and 4G network covers about 97% of the population.
  • Individual Wireless segment generated revenues of ₱63.2 billion for the first nine months of 2025.

Here's a snapshot of the Enterprise segment, which leverages this integrated ecosystem:

Metric Value (9M 2025) YoY Change
PLDT Enterprise Revenues ₱35.6 billion N/A
Corporate Data/ICT Revenues ₱26.7 billion Up 2%
Overall ICT Revenues N/A Up 27%

High-speed, reliable fiber connectivity (97% of Home revenue is fiber)

For the Home segment, the value proposition is clear: premium, high-speed fiber connectivity, rapidly phasing out older technologies. This focus drives premium pricing and low customer attrition. Honestly, the numbers show customers are willing to pay for this reliability.

Key performance indicators for PLDT Home in the first nine months of 2025:

  • Fiber-only revenues grew 7% year-on-year, reaching ₱44.5 billion.
  • Fiber accounted for 97% of total Home revenues, which stood at ₱45.7 billion.
  • Total fiber connections reached 3.63 million as of end-September 2025.
  • The industry's highest Average Revenue Per User (ARPU) was ₱1,485 in the first half of 2025.
  • Churn remained at the industry's lowest rate of 1.93% in H1 2025.

Seamless digital finance and payment solutions through Maya

Maya is delivering a significant financial turnaround, proving the value of PLDT Inc.'s diversification into fintech. It's no longer just a cost center; it's a profit contributor.

Maya's financial impact for the first half of 2025:

Metric Value (H1 2025) Context
Core Income Contribution ₱406 million A P1.1 billion turnaround from prior year's loss
Bank Customer Base 8.2 million Deposits reached ₱50.4 billion
Q2 2025 Net Income ₱582 million Strong quarterly performance

By the third quarter of 2025, the momentum continued:

  • Deposit balances climbed to ₱57 billion, up 59% year-on-year.
  • Total loan disbursements reached ₱187 billion since the launch of Maya Bank.
  • The equity share from Maya's core income helped PLDT's consolidated core income reach ₱25.8 billion for the first nine months of 2025.

Enterprise-grade cloud, cybersecurity, and data center offerings

For enterprise customers, the value is in advanced, secure digital transformation services built on top of the core network. The growth in ICT services, especially data centers and cybersecurity, is outpacing general corporate data revenue growth.

Data center performance via VITRO Inc. and ePLDT (9M 2025):

  • ePLDT and VITRO Inc. posted combined revenues of ₱4.88 billion, a 24% year-on-year increase.
  • Data center colocation revenues specifically jumped 36% compared to a year ago.
  • VITRO Sta. Rosa, the AI-ready hyperscale data center, offers 50 MW of capacity, which is half of VITRO's total portfolio capacity of 100 MW.

Cybersecurity and managed services show strong adoption:

  • Cybersecurity services revenue rose by 69% in Q1 2025.
  • Managed IT services expanded by 101% in Q1 2025.

Network resilience via the 'Always On' fiber-to-wireless failover modem

This is a direct response to the necessity of uninterrupted connectivity, treating internet access like a utility. The 'Always On' modem provides automatic failover from fiber to a wireless connection, and it even manages the service request for you. That's defintely a strong value-add for remote workers and online learners.

The specifics of the 'Always On' add-on service (as of late 2024/early 2025):

Feature Specification/Cost
Add-on Cost ₱299 per month (on top of plan)
Backup Technology Unlimited LTE (powered by Smart)
LTE Backup Speed (Max Download) Up to 300 Mbps
Automatic Action on Fiber Loss Generates a repair ticket automatically

PLDT Inc. (PHI) - Canvas Business Model: Customer Relationships

Hyper-segmented and personalized mobile offers using data analytics

PLDT Inc. uses data analytics to tailor offers for its mobile base. Active data users reached 42.4 million as of end-September 2025. Mobile data revenues, which include Fixed Wireless Access (FWA), totaled ₱57.3 billion for the first nine months of 2025, marking a 1% increase year-on-year. Mobile data revenues alone were ₱56 billion, also up 1%. This personalization is supported by Customer Value Management (CVM) initiatives that adjust offers based on usage patterns to keep the prepaid base active. The 5G device base continues to drive usage; the share of 5G devices in the total base improved to 18% by the third quarter of 2025. For the first half of 2025, 5G traffic surged by 84% year-on-year.

The segmentation efforts are visible across the mobile data landscape:

  • Mobile data revenues (9M 2025): ₱56 billion
  • Fixed Wireless Access (FWA) revenues (9M 2025): Growth of 18%
  • Overall data traffic growth (9M 2025): 6%

Dedicated account management for large Enterprise and Government clients

For Enterprise and Government clients, PLDT Enterprise focuses on high-value, contract-specific services. Enterprise revenues for the first nine months of 2025 reached ₱35.6 billion. Within this, Corporate Data/ICT revenues showed a return to growth, increasing by 2% to ₱26.7 billion for the same period. Contract-specific services specifically saw a strong increase of 25%, tied to the ramp-up of key ICT projects. The public sector segment experienced some near-term friction, as deal closures were impacted by changes following the May elections in the first half of 2025.

Enterprise Segment Metric (9M 2025) Amount (PHP) Year-on-Year Change
PLDT Enterprise Revenues ₱35.6 billion Not specified
Corp Data/ICT Revenues ₱26.7 billion +2%
Contract-Specific Services Growth N/A +25%

Digital self-service and support via the Maya and Smart apps

Digital self-service is heavily channeled through the Maya and Smart applications, which are central to PLDT Inc.'s digital ecosystem. Maya, the fintech platform, sustained its profitability streak, delivering its third consecutive profitable quarter in Q3 2025, with a net income of ₱532 million in that quarter alone. The Maya bank customer base expanded to nine million as of the third quarter of 2025, with deposit balances reaching ₱57 billion, a 59% surge year-on-year. For the core mobile business, Smart's combined 5G/4G network covers approximately 97% of the population, ensuring broad digital access for support channels.

Key Maya financial and user metrics (as of 9M 2025):

  • Maya Bank Customer Base: 9 million users
  • Maya Deposit Balances: ₱57 billion
  • Maya Total Loan Disbursements (Since Launch): ₱187 billion

Community digital inclusion programs like AI-in-a-Box

PLDT Inc. actively engages in community digital inclusion, using programs to upskill various sectors. The AI-in-a-Box initiative, which brings artificial intelligence (AI) training to communities, reached over 1,100 individuals in the first half of 2025. This group included media practitioners, LGU staff, freelancers, farmers, persons with disabilities, women at risk, and MSMEs. Separately, the Group's cybersecurity awareness campaign, #BeCyberSmart, reached more than 2,000 participants, covering students, teachers, parents, MSMEs, farmers, and media practitioners during the same period.

High-touch service for high-ARPU fiber subscribers

The high-value fiber segment receives service quality that supports premium pricing and low churn. PLDT Home maintained industry leadership with the highest Average Revenue Per User (ARPU) at ₱1,485 in the first half of 2025. Fiber-only revenues grew by 7% year-on-year to ₱44.5 billion for the first nine months of 2025, now constituting 97% of total Home revenues. Total fiber subscribers reached 3.63 million as of end-September 2025. A key indicator of high-touch service success is plan adoption: well over 80% of new customers chose higher-value broadband plans (₱1,299 and up), and 87% of the total subscriber mix is on plans of ₱1,000-and-up.

PLDT Inc. (PHI) - Canvas Business Model: Cost Structure

You're looking at the major outflows for PLDT Inc. (PHI) as of late 2025, focusing on what it takes to keep that massive network running and expanding. The cost structure is heavily weighted toward infrastructure investment and the ongoing operational expense of a nationwide telecom footprint.

Capital Expenditure (CapEx) for network build-out is a primary driver. For the full 2025 fiscal year, PLDT Inc. has guided its CapEx to approximately ₱60 billion. This spending is directed at new cell sites, 5G upgrades, home fiber port expansion, and modernizing IT infrastructure, including AI-ready data centers and submarine cable investments. As of the first nine months of 2025, the actual spending was reported at ₱43.0 billion, showing a lower capital intensity ratio of 27% for that period, which is a positive sign for cash flow management.

The operational costs, which include network operating costs, including power and site maintenance, are managed tightly, as evidenced by the steady profitability metrics. The company maintained a consolidated EBITDA margin of 52% in the first half of 2025 and for the first nine months of 2025. This margin reflects the balance between revenues and operating expenses before accounting for depreciation, amortization, and financing charges.

Depreciation and amortization is a significant, non-cash charge reflecting the wear and tear of the extensive physical assets. While the specific figure of ₱26.043 billion for 1H 2025 was requested, the latest reported consolidated EBITDA for the first nine months of 2025 was ₱82.8 billion, with a 52% margin.

Personnel and employee benefits costs are necessary to manage the operations, sales, and technology development across the entire group. The cost structure is supported by a large operational base, with 41.6 million active mobile data users as of mid-2025 and over 59 million mobile subscribers as of end-June 2025.

Financing costs from debt for infrastructure investments are managed through a disciplined approach to leverage. As of end-September 2025, Consolidated Net Debt stood at ₱289.0 billion, with Gross Debt at ₱299.4 billion. This debt load supports the ongoing capital-intensive nature of the business. To be fair, managing the interest expense on this level of debt is a constant focus for the finance team.

Here is a snapshot of the key financial metrics that define the cost side of the PLDT Inc. equation as of the latest available data in 2025:

Cost Component/Metric Value (PHP) Period/Context
Full Year 2025 CapEx Guidance ₱60 billion Full Year 2025 Guidance
CapEx Incurred ₱43.0 billion 9 Months Ended September 2025
Consolidated EBITDA ₱82.8 billion 9 Months Ended September 2025
EBITDA Margin 52% 1H 2025 and 9M 2025
Net Debt ₱289.0 billion End-September 2025
Gross Debt ₱299.4 billion End-September 2025

The company is clearly focused on efficiency, as shown by the reduced CapEx guidance and the stable EBITDA margin, even while servicing substantial debt. The goal is to drive positive free cash flow, which was achieved as of September 2025, ahead of the initial 2026 forecast.

  • Network build-out spending is prioritized for revenue-generating infrastructure.
  • EBITDA margin stability at 52% signals tight control over operating expenses.
  • Debt management is key, with 13% of Gross Debt denominated in U.S. dollars.
  • The company achieved positive free cash flows as of September 2025.

PLDT Inc. (PHI) - Canvas Business Model: Revenue Streams

You're looking at how PLDT Inc. (PHI) is bringing in the cash as of late 2025. Honestly, the story is all about data and fiber dominance, with the fintech arm finally pulling its weight. Here's the quick math on where the money is coming from based on the first nine months of 2025 results.

Mobile Data and Broadband Subscriptions are the engine room, making up a massive chunk of the business. Data and broadband revenues accounted for 85% of Consolidated Service Revenues for the first nine months of 2025, hitting a total of ₱123.6 billion. That's the core of the operation right there.

The fixed line side is clearly pivoting to fiber. Fixed Broadband (Fiber) Revenue saw solid growth, increasing 7% to reach ₱44.5 billion in the 9M 2025 period. This revenue stream now makes up 97% of the total PLDT Home revenues, which were ₱45.7 billion for the same nine months. It's a clear sign that the massive fiber buildout is paying off in the top line.

For the Enterprise and ICT Services segment, we're seeing a return to growth, which is good news given the capital intensity of that sector. Corporate data and ICT revenues grew by 2% in 9M 2025, totaling ₱26.7 billion. Overall Enterprise revenues for the period were ₱35.6 billion. Within that, ICT revenues, which include things like managed IT and cybersecurity, were up a strong 27% year-on-year.

The digital side, Digital Financial Services via Maya, is now a contributor to the bottom line, not just a drain. For the 9M 2025 period, Maya contributed ₱603 million to PLDT's core income. This marks a significant turnaround, as the company sustained profitability for the third consecutive quarter. Maya's bank customer base reached 8.2 million as of end-June 2025, with deposits climbing to ₱50.4 billion.

We can't forget the Legacy Services. Voice and SMS are definitely a declining revenue source, which is why the overall Wireless Consumer segment revenue was slightly down at ₱63.2 billion for 9M 2025, despite mobile data growth. The drag from these older services is what PLDT has to constantly offset with its newer offerings.

Here is a snapshot of the key revenue drivers for the first nine months of 2025:

Revenue Stream Category 9M 2025 Value (PHP) Year-on-Year Growth/Share
Data and Broadband (Total) ₱123.6 billion 85% of Net Service Revenues
Fixed Broadband (Fiber) Revenue ₱44.5 billion Grew 7%
Corporate Data/ICT Revenue ₱26.7 billion Grew 2%
Total Wireless Consumer Revenue ₱63.2 billion Slightly down due to legacy brands
Maya Contribution to Core Income ₱603 million Positive Contributor

You can see the strategic shift clearly when you break down the Wireless segment, too. Mobile data and fixed wireless combined are where the focus is:

  • Mobile Data Revenues: ₱56 billion (up 1%)
  • Fixed Wireless Revenues: Up 18% year-on-year
  • Total Data (Mobile Data + Fixed Wireless): ₱57.3 billion (up 1%), accounting for 91% of total wireless revenues.
